Put Cancelled Internships on Resume?

So my summer internship at an MM IB got cancelled and so did my semester internship at an asset management firm. I was wondering whether I should list both of the internships on my resume and add cancelled due to Covid-19. People seem to have different opinions on whether to put cancelled internships on your resume or not, but both companies have recognizable brand names across the industry so I thought it could be slightly helpful- not sure whether to put both of them though. Any insight would be appreciated!

Hmm I'm not entirely sure, but maybe something like: "Investment Banking Summer Analyst at Midmarket Capital - Cancelled Due to COVID-19". Don't think your previously expected start date etc would be necessary. I would forsure appreciate seeing the above on a resume though given it shows you were able to score that job in the first place. Let me know if helpful
